Our 2025 Mardi Gras Parade will take place on Tuesday,March 4, at 10 a.m. The history of the Gulf Shores Mardi Gras parade dates back to 1978 when a group of locals decided Gulf Shores needed a parade. Those locals formed the Pleasure Island Players and thus Mardi Gras began in Gulf Shores. As the Gulf Coast gears up for the 2025 Mardi Gras season, the communities of Gulf Shores, Orange Beach, and Foley are finalizing preparations for parades and festivities spanning multiple days. Featuring colorful floats, marching bands, and family-friendly events, the region's celebrations have started and culminate on Fat Tuesday, March 4, drawing locals and visitors alike into the streets The City of Gulf Shores will host its 46th Annual Mardi Gras Parade on Fat Tuesday, March 4, at 10 a.m. The parade will begin at the intersection of Highway 59 and East Beach Boulevard (Highway 182) and will travel along East Beach Boulevard to the Gulf State Park Pier Road. More than 50 units take part in the annual City of Orange Beach Mardi Gras parade. Participating groups include Orange Beach High School band and cheerleaders, Gulf Shores High School band, Bon Temps Cabrix, Treasures of the Isle, Sirens of the Sea, Order of Disorder, Order of Aurora, Maidens in Pink Stilettos and Mystics of Pleasure Mardi Gras brings lots of amazing events and parades to our shores, but there’s more than just catching beads.
